The difference is that Chopin is made from POTATOES rather than from grain like most American and Russian vodkas. Potato vodka is much cleaner and smoother than grain alcohol. I'll leave it to the chemists to sort out why, but to my palate it's a fact.

Try Monopolowa from Austria, another potato vodka. Trader Joe's now gets a special bottling (not their usual fancy label with the Vienna ferris wheel through the bottle) that they sell for about 10 bucks for a full liter (not the usual 750 ml). It's great straight and frozen, on the rocks with a twist (I've got a Meyer lemon tree), or mixed with everything from Clamato to Red Bull.
